  • Decomposition of Lead Oxide: Chemical Reaction & Process
    Lead oxide, when heated, undergoes a chemical change known as decomposition. Decomposition is a process in which a compound breaks down into simpler substances or elements. In the case of lead oxide, when heated, it decomposes into lead and oxygen.

    The chemical equation for the decomposition of lead oxide is:

    2PbO(s) → 2Pb(s) + O2(g)

    In this reaction, solid lead oxide (PbO) breaks down to form solid lead (Pb) and oxygen gas (O2).

    The decomposition of lead oxide occurs at a relatively high temperature. The exact temperature at which it decomposes depends on the specific compound and the conditions under which it is heated.
